Changed defaults for the Brightfern clinic reminder job (v2.9). Heads up, future maintainers: the job now sends reminders 48 hours out instead of 24, after the Oakhollow pilot showed fewer no-shows. Quiet hours are respected by default, and SMS retries dropped from five to two because carriers were flagging us. If you need the old behavior, override it per-tenant. The job ships with the following default configuration values.

config for yajef-tajof:
[belius]
host = belius.crelvolabs.internal
user = belius_svc
database = belius_prod

Ticket: Staging env misconfigured for Siftgate bloom filter

The bloom layer in front of the Pellet KV store is rejecting all lookups in staging because the env file was copied from the dev template without credentials. False-positive tuning values are fine; only the auth line is missing. To unblock the weekly demo, the Pellet admission secret must be set on the following line.

env line for yaguf-fajop: LEDGER_TOKEN13=fb08984397349

## Restarting the Crashfeed Ingest

Welcome aboard! When PebbleTrack's crash-report pipeline backs up, it's almost always the ingest worker wedged on a malformed payload from an old app build. Drain the queue, bounce the worker, and watch the dashboard for five minutes. Before restarting, make sure the worker's environment matches what's below — drift here is the usual culprit.

settings of yageg-yahap:
[gorael]
team = olieth
access_code = ac_941d74
owner = brieth.aldiel
host = gorael.tolvaqio.internal
port = 6379
peer = briwyn.urlaqtech.internal
salt = 116e6622
pin = 1957

## Proctor Queue API

The Sentry Owl queue manages exam-proctoring sessions. Producers enqueue session-start events; workers claim them in FIFO order with a 90-second lease. Unclaimed leases requeue automatically. All endpoints require a service credential in the request header. For local development against the staging queue, use the key below.

gateway credential: kto3_qfe